ATSAM3X4E | Microchip Technology

Overview

  • Part Family:ATSAM3X4E
  • CPU Type:Cortex-M3
  • MaxSpeed (MHz):84
  • Program Memory Size (KB):256
  • SRAM (KB):64
  • Temp. Range Min.:-40
  • Temp. Range Max.:85
  • Operation Voltage Min.(V):1.62
  • Operation Voltage Max.(V):3.6
  • SPI:4
  • I2C:2
  • UART:5
  • QSPI:0
  • Crypto Engine:No
  • Internal Oscillator:4,8,12Mhz,32Khz
  • Pin Count:144

  • ARM Cortex-M3 revision 2.0 running at up to 84 MHz
  • Memory Protection Unit (MPU)
  • 24-bit SysTick Counter
  • Thumb®-2 instruction set
  • Nested Vector Interrupt Controller
  • 2 x 128 Kbytes embedded Flash, 128-bit wide access, memory accelerator, dual bank
  • 2 x 32 Kbytes embedded SRAM with dual banks
  • 16 Kbytes ROM with embedded bootloader routines (UART, USB) and IAP routines
  • Static Memory Controller (SMC): SRAM, NOR, NAND support.
  • NAND Flash controller with 4 Kbytes RAM buffer and ECC
  • External Bus Interface - 16 bits, 8 chip selects, 23-bit address
  • Embedded voltage regulator for single-supply operation
  • POR, BOD and Watchdog for safe reset
  • Quartz or resonator oscillators: 3 to 20 MHz main and optional low power 32.768 kHz for RTC or device clock
  • High precision 8/12 MHz factory trimmed internal RC oscillator with 4 MHz Default Frequency for fast device startup
  • Slow Clock Internal RC oscillator as permanent clock for device clock in low power mode
  • One PLL for device clock and one dedicated PLL for USB 2.0 High Speed Mini Host/Device
  • Temperature Sensor
  • 17 peripheral DMA (PDC) channels and 6-channel central DMA plus dedicated DMA for High-Speed USB Mini Host/Device and Ethernet MAC
  • Sleep, Wait and Backup modes, down to 2.5 μA in Backup mode with RTC, RTT, and GPBR
  • 144-lead LQFP – 20 x 20 mm, pitch 0.5 mm
  • 144-ball LFBGA – 10 x 10 mm, pitch 0.8 mm
  • Industrial (-40° C to +85° C)
  • USB 2.0 Device/Mini Host: 480 Mbps, 4 Kbyte FIFO, up to 10 bidirectional Endpoints, dedicated DMA
  • 4 USARTs (ISO7816, IrDA®, Flow Control, SPI, Manchester and LIN support) and one UART
  • 2 TWI (I2C compatible), up to 6 SPIs, 1 SSC (I2S), 1 HSMCI (SDIO/SD/MMC) with up to 2 slots
  • 9-channel 32-bit Timer Counter (TC) for capture, compare and PWM mode, Quadrature Decoder Logic and 2-bit Gray Up/Down Counter for Stepper Motor
  • 32-bit low-power Real-time Timer (RTT) and low-power Real-time Clock (RTC) with calendar and alarm features
  • 256-bit General Purpose Backup Registers (GPBR)
  • Ethernet MAC 10/100 (EMAC - MII/RMII) with dedicated DMA
  • 2 CAN Controllers with 8 Mailboxes
  • True Random Number Generator (TRNG)
  • 103 I/O lines with external interrupt capability (edge or level sensitivity), debouncing, glitch filtering and on-die Series Resistor Termination
  • Six 32-bit Parallel Input/Output Controllers
  • 16-channel 12-bit 1 msps ADC with differential input mode and programmable gain stage
  • 2-channel 12-bit 1 msps DAC
  • Serial Wire/JTAG Debug Port(SWJ-DP)
  • Debug access to all memories and registers in the system, including Cortex-M4 register bank when the core is running, halted, or held in reset.
  • Serial Wire Debug Port (SW-DP) and Serial Wire JTAG Debug Port (SWJ-DP) debug access.
  • Flash Patch and Breakpoint (FPB) unit for implementing breakpoints and code patches.
  • Data Watchpoint and Trace (DWT) unit for implementing watchpoints, data tracing, and system profiling.
  • Instrumentation Trace Macrocell (ITM) for support of printf style debugging.
  • IEEE1149.1 JTAG Boundary-scan on all digital pins.
  • ASF-Atmel software Framework – SAM software development framework
  • Integrated in the Atmel Studio IDE with a graphical user interface or available as standalone for GCC, IAR compilers.
  • DMA support, Interrupt handlers Driver support
  • USB, TCP/IP, Wi-Fi and Bluetooth, Numerous USB classes, DHCP and Wi-Fi encryption Stacks
  • RTOS integration, FreeRTOS is a core component
